SpaceX bills around $100 million per launch to NASA or the DoD, (15) but . this drops to $50 million or $60 million for an equiva-lent launch on the … WebThe SpaceX reusable rocket technology is being developed for both Falcon 9 v1.2 and Falcon Heavy. SpaceX initially attempted to land the first stage of the Falcon 1 by parachute, but the stage did not survive re-entry into the atmosphere. They continued to experiment unsuccessfully with parachutes on the earliest Falcon 9 flights after 2010.
